Skip to content

BLE2904

Descriptor for Characteristic Presentation Format.

詳細情報

メンバー

FORMAT_BOOLEAN

const uint8_t BLE2904::FORMAT_BOOLEAN

FORMAT_UINT2

const uint8_t BLE2904::FORMAT_UINT2

FORMAT_UINT4

const uint8_t BLE2904::FORMAT_UINT4

FORMAT_UINT8

const uint8_t BLE2904::FORMAT_UINT8

FORMAT_UINT12

const uint8_t BLE2904::FORMAT_UINT12

FORMAT_UINT16

const uint8_t BLE2904::FORMAT_UINT16

FORMAT_UINT24

const uint8_t BLE2904::FORMAT_UINT24

FORMAT_UINT32

const uint8_t BLE2904::FORMAT_UINT32

FORMAT_UINT48

const uint8_t BLE2904::FORMAT_UINT48

FORMAT_UINT64

const uint8_t BLE2904::FORMAT_UINT64

FORMAT_UINT128

const uint8_t BLE2904::FORMAT_UINT128

FORMAT_SINT8

const uint8_t BLE2904::FORMAT_SINT8

FORMAT_SINT12

const uint8_t BLE2904::FORMAT_SINT12

FORMAT_SINT16

const uint8_t BLE2904::FORMAT_SINT16

FORMAT_SINT24

const uint8_t BLE2904::FORMAT_SINT24

FORMAT_SINT32

const uint8_t BLE2904::FORMAT_SINT32

FORMAT_SINT48

const uint8_t BLE2904::FORMAT_SINT48

FORMAT_SINT64

const uint8_t BLE2904::FORMAT_SINT64

FORMAT_SINT128

const uint8_t BLE2904::FORMAT_SINT128

FORMAT_FLOAT32

const uint8_t BLE2904::FORMAT_FLOAT32

FORMAT_FLOAT64

const uint8_t BLE2904::FORMAT_FLOAT64

FORMAT_SFLOAT16

const uint8_t BLE2904::FORMAT_SFLOAT16

FORMAT_SFLOAT32

const uint8_t BLE2904::FORMAT_SFLOAT32

FORMAT_IEEE20601

const uint8_t BLE2904::FORMAT_IEEE20601

FORMAT_UTF8

const uint8_t BLE2904::FORMAT_UTF8

FORMAT_UTF16

const uint8_t BLE2904::FORMAT_UTF16

FORMAT_OPAQUE

const uint8_t BLE2904::FORMAT_OPAQUE

BLE2904()

BLE2904::BLE2904()

setDescription()

Set the description.

void BLE2904::setDescription(uint16_t)

引数

  • uint16_t ``

setExponent()

Set the exponent.

void BLE2904::setExponent(int8_t exponent)

引数

  • int8_t exponent

setFormat()

Set the format.

void BLE2904::setFormat(uint8_t format)

引数

  • uint8_t format

setNamespace()

Set the namespace.

void BLE2904::setNamespace(uint8_t namespace_value)

引数

  • uint8_t namespace_value

setUnit()

Set the units for this value. It should be one of the encoded values defined here:

void BLE2904::setUnit(uint16_t unit)

引数

  • uint16_t unit The type of units of this characteristic as defined by assigned numbers.